What sets Polish Pottery apart is the intricate hand-stamping technique used by highly skilled artists. Inspired by nature, these artists create a wide array of designs and colors that are simply mesmerizing. The "Black Spray" pattern falls under the category of "simpler" patterns, but don't let that fool you. The demand for these patterns is so high that a large pool of talented artists work tirelessly to meet it. As a result, each piece of Polish Pottery is unique and showcases the artist's individual touch.

This particular product is manufactured by Manufaktura, the first pottery manufacturer that The Polish Pottery Outlet chose to collaborate with when they opened in 2006. Established in 1992, Manufaktura has gained recognition for their stunning designs and their efforts to promote Polish pottery worldwide. They are seen as trendsetters in the industry and are considered one of the most important producers of Polish pottery in Boleslawiec. Cleaning
Polish Pottery is Dishwasher safe! Or, clean by hand using regular dish soap and scrub brush.
Guidelines to keep your pottery in excellent condition:
You may safely use Polish pottery in the microwave and in a conventional oven at temperatures up to 425°F. We recommend you heat your stoneware up to temperature with the oven. Make sure to always cover the entire bottom of the dish when baking. For example, you don't want to put a single chicken breast in the center of a baker and leave the rest of the surface area uncovered, as the empty spots will heat at a different rate than those with food on them. Polish pottery does not like quick changes in temperature or uneven heat sources, and thermal shock WILL result in a broken dish.
Never place your pottery directly on a hot stovetop burner!
While Polish pottery is extremely durable, it should not be taken directly from the freezer and placed into a hot oven. In addition, cold water or frozen food should not be placed in a hot piece of pottery. Always allow cooling or warming to room temperatures before heating in an oven or placing in a freezer. If taken care of properly, your Polish pottery can last for generations!
